        I have the basic hierarchy set up for the classes and modules. It's nice to be able to see all of a classes methods and inherited methods on a single page ; for example Sketchup::Edge.

        0118.png

        The next most important work is to add @return tags to as many methods as possible in order to enable linking the return values to the documentation for the returned type.

        For example, the following would enable linking back to the Array class in the documentation, which is handy when following the method lookup chain of SketchUp objects.

        module Sketchup
          class Edge
            # @return [Array] an array of connected entities plus the edge itself.
            def all_connected
            end
          end
        end
        

        See the yard guide for more info.
